Use a 3-part hashtag strategy

Combine (1) 2–4 broad hashtags, (2) 5–10 niche hashtags, and (3) 2–5 long-tail hashtags. This balances discovery with targeting for stronger engagement signals.

Match hashtags to on-screen text and audio

TikTok understands keywords from your on-screen text and spoken words. Align your hashtags with those phrases to improve TikTok SEO and search visibility.

Rotate sets, don’t copy-paste forever

Create 3–5 hashtag sets per content pillar and rotate them. This helps you test which communities and keyword clusters drive the best views and follows.

Prioritize relevance over “viral” tags

Irrelevant trending tags can hurt retention and engagement. Strong niche relevance often outperforms generic tags over time—especially for consistent growth.

How to choose TikTok hashtags that actually get views (not just vibes)

TikTok hashtags are not magic keywords, but they still matter a lot. They help TikTok understand what your video is about, what community it belongs to, and who might want to see it. And yes, they also help with TikTok search.

The problem is most people do one of these:

  • Stuff the caption with random trending tags
  • Use the same copy paste set on every post
  • Only use super broad tags like #fyp and hope for the best

This usually gives you messy targeting. Lots of impressions, low watch time, weak engagement. TikTok notices.

A better approach is simple. Build a hashtag set that matches the actual intent of the video.

The 3 bucket TikTok hashtag strategy

When you generate hashtags, aim for a mix like this:

1) Broad and discovery hashtags (a few only)

These are bigger tags that give TikTok a general category.

Examples:

  • #fitness
  • #skincare
  • #realestate
  • #booktok

Use 2 to 4. If you add 15 broad tags, you basically told TikTok nothing specific.

2) Niche and community hashtags (the core)

These are the tags that do the heavy lifting. They connect you to the right viewers.

Examples:

  • #beginnerworkout
  • #acneskincare
  • #firsttimehomebuyer
  • #romancebooks

Use 5 to 10 depending on caption length.

3) Long tail intent hashtags (the secret sauce)

These are specific phrases people search, or the exact problem your video solves.

Examples:

  • #homeworkoutforweightloss
  • #skincareroutineforacne
  • #howtobuyahouse
  • #spicyromancerecs

Use 2 to 5. They often look “too specific” but that is the point.

What to type into a TikTok hashtag generator (so the output is better)

If you only type “workout” you will get generic results. Instead, give it a clean keyword plus context.

Try this format:

  • Topic: what the video is about in 3 to 6 words
  • Niche: the community you want (optional but helpful)
  • Caption: paste your actual hook and offer (optional, but best for accuracy)
  • Location: only if you want local reach

Example input:

  • Topic: beginner home workout for weight loss
  • Niche: fitness for beginners
  • Caption: “No equipment. 15 minutes. Easy fat loss routine at home.”

Now your hashtags can match the hook, the promise, and the audience. Way more aligned.

Should you use #fyp or #viral?

You can, sometimes. But they are insanely broad and competitive. If you use them, treat them like seasoning.

A decent rule:

  • If your set is mostly niche and long tail, adding 1 broad tag like #fyp is fine.
  • If your set is mostly broad, adding #fyp does not save it.

For consistent growth, niche relevance tends to win. Especially if your content is not “mass meme” content.

TikTok SEO: where hashtags fit in (and where they do not)

Hashtags help, but they are only one signal. TikTok also reads:

  • Your caption text
  • On screen text
  • Spoken words in the audio
  • Comments and engagement patterns

So the best move is alignment. If your video says “beginner home workout” on screen, and your caption says it too, then your hashtags should echo that same keyword cluster.

Quick checklist before you post

  • Are at least 70% of your hashtags directly about the video?
  • Do you have niche tags that describe the exact audience?
  • Do you have a couple long tail tags that match what someone would search?
  • Did you avoid irrelevant trend tags just because they are popular?

If you can say yes, you are already ahead of most creators.
